VIENNA, VA — A heavy fire caused one injury in Vienna early Saturday, according to Fairfax County Fire and Rescue. The fire happened around 4:28 a.m. Saturday in the 100 block of Park Street NE. Units encountered heavy fire upon arrival at the single-family home and requested a second alarm. Firefighters bought the fire under control with an exterior attack followed by an interior attack. Firefighters located one resident and helped him evacuate. Smoke alarms sounded in the home, but the resident could not hear them. The resident went to the hospital with non-life-threatening injuries. According to fire investigators, the fire started on the second floor. The cause was the combustion of home improvement materials such as sawdust, floor stain cans and rags. Damages were estimated to be $513,500. One resident was displaced due to the fire. Red Cross assistance was declined.
